# Python操作 在计算机科学中,运算是二进制数操作一种方式。在Python中,(XOR)是一种非常重要操作,我们通常用符号 `^` 来表示。本文将介绍概念、运算规则及其在Python应用,并提供相关代码示例。 ## 1. 什么是或是一种二进制操作,它对两个比特进行比较并根据以下规则生成结果: - 如果两个比特位相同(都
原创 10月前
171阅读
编码:用来存放一01,就是计算机里最小存储单位,叫做【】,也叫【比特】(bit)。我们决定8个比特构成一个【字节】(byte),这是计算机里最常用单位。1 byte = 8 bit 也就是一个字节等于8比特编码表按照时间顺序有以下:编码表就是计算机世界字典计算机是有自己工作区,这个工作区被称为“内存”,数据在内存当中处理时,使用格式是Unicode,统一标准.在python3当中
转载 2023-09-27 21:31:39
190阅读
深入理解运算符参与运算两个值,如果两个相应bit位相同,则结果为0,否则为1。即:   0^0 = 0,       1^0 = 1,       0^1 = 1,       1^1 = 03个特点
运算:首先表示当两个数二进制表示,进行运算时,当前两个二进制表示不同则为1相同则为0.该方法被广泛推广用来统计一个数1位数!参与运算两个值,如果两个相应bit位相同,则结果为0,否则为1。 即:   0^0 = 0,    1^0 = 1,    0^1 = 1,    1^1 = 0 3个特点: (1) 0^0=0,0^1=1&nb
转载 2023-08-25 20:04:56
169阅读
python中:运算,都运算,都是把参加运算二进制形式进行运算。1.与运算:A与B值均为1时,A、B与运算结果才为1,否则为0 (运算符:&)2.运算:AB值为1时,A、B运算结果才为1,否则为0  (运算符:|)3.运算:A与B不同为1时,A、B预算结果才为1,否则为0  (运算符:^)4.翻转(取反)
转载 2023-06-06 10:09:26
715阅读
# Python运算符实现教程 ## 一、概述 运算(XOR)是一种常见运算,在计算机科学中有着广泛应用。在Python中,您可以通过`^`运算符实现运算。但如果您需要逐对两个数字做运算,您可能会想对其每一进行操作。 本指南将引导您一步一步地实现利用比特进行逐运算。下面是实现该功能一系列流程和步骤。 ## 二、流程示意 您可以参考以下表格来
(&、|、^):按照二进制进行逻辑运算例如:数字换成二进制,各自0/1进行逻辑运算,得到结果转换为数字3 & 2=0111 & 0010=0010=2二进制逻辑运算规则:&:0&0=0; 0&1=0; 1&0=0; 1&1=1。|:0|0=0; 0|1=1; 1|0=1; 1|1=1。^:0^0=0; 0^1=1; 1
''' python运算符:python运算符是把数字看作二进制来进行计算与(&):如果两个二进位都为1,则该位结果为1,否则为0 (|):只要一个为1,则为1,否则为0 (^):两个二进位相异为为1(即两个二进位要相反),否则为0 取反(~):对数据每个二进制取反,即把1变0,把0变1 左移动:运算数各二进位全部向左移若干 右移动:运算数各二进位全
转载 2023-06-04 16:31:07
444阅读
# 如何在Python中实现(XOR)操作 (XOR)是一种基本运算,它对于许多数据处理和加密场景都非常有用。在这篇文章中,我们将通过一个简单示例来学习如何在Python中实现操作。我们将分解这个过程为几个步骤,并且会使用代码示例进行演示。 ## 整体流程 我们将整个流程分为以下四个步骤: | 步骤 | 描述 | |
原创 8月前
49阅读
运算符:是指对二进制从低位到高位对齐后进行运算。1、与 & 二进制“与”运算规则:1&1=1 1&0=0 0&0=0例如: $n=6; $m=12; $n&$m=???其中;6 = 二进制   110;12= 二进制1100; $n&$m=10 01101100==》0100(二进制)===》10(十进
转载 2023-12-12 17:03:57
141阅读
我们先了解一下运算法则吧:1、a^b = b^a。2、(a^b)^c = a^(b^c)。3、a^b^a = b。对于一个任意一个数 n,它有几个特殊性质:1、0^n = n。2、n^n = 0。3、1^n = !n。(即 n==0 时,则所得值为真,当 n != 0,所得值为 0,即为假) 3 个特点:(1) 0^0=0,0^1=1  0 任何数=任
转载 2023-12-19 22:10:44
454阅读
操作是计算机科学中常见运算之一。在 Python 中,可以使用`^`运算符来实现规则非常简单:对于二进制中相同位置,如果两个位相同,则结果为 0;如果不同,则结果为 1。 ## 环境准备 在开始之前,确保你有以下环境准备: - **前置依赖安装**: - Python 3.x 已安装。 - 以下是版本兼容性矩阵: | 软件/库 |
# Python实现 ## 引言 在Python中,或是一种常用操作。对于刚入行小白来说,可能不太清楚如何实现这个功能。本文将介绍Python实现过程,并提供对应代码示例。 ## 定义 或是指对两个二进制数进行操作。其规则如下: - 如果两个对应二进制位相同,则结果为0; - 如果两个对应二进制不同,则结果为1。 ## 实现
原创 2023-07-21 12:41:54
208阅读
符号表达: 逻辑与 逻辑 逻辑 & | ^ 说明:很多人不容易理解这些符号说明,就很迷糊,这里我用简单语言进行说明,看完相信你会有所收获! 逻辑:带有这两个字通常就是两个boolean表达式运算。比如:(3>5) & (1<2) :带有这两个字通常是十进
原创 2021-07-23 16:55:33
3025阅读
1.说明python操作符我们一般不常见,但是很有用:   运算,都是参加运算二进制形式进行运算。    1.与运算:A与B值均为1时,A、B与运算结果才为1,否则为0 (运算符:&)    2.运算:AB值为1时,A、B运算结果才为1,否则为0  (运算符:|)    3.运算:A与B不同为1时,A、B预算结果才为1,否则为0&n
转载 2023-05-30 21:15:55
304阅读
python中也有和C/C++类似的运算,与数学中逻辑运算符(且、、非)一样运算符是把数字看作二进制来进行计算Python运算法则如下:与 ( bitwise and of x and y )& 举例: 5&3 = 1 解释: 101 11 相同位仅为个位1 ,故结果为 1 ( bitwise or of x and y )| 举例: 5|3 =
参加运算两个数据,二进制进行运算。 与(&) 两同时为“1”,结果才为“1”,否则为0 例如:3&5:0011 & 0101 = 0001 所以3&5=1 1&2 : 0001 & 0010 = 0000 所以1&2=0 9&5 : 1001 & 0101 = 0001 所以9&5=1 ( ...
转载 2021-08-31 18:07:00
541阅读
2评论
首先分别解释一下:指的是参与运算两个数分别对应二进制进行“操作。只要对应两个二进制有一个为1时,结果位就为1。python中运算符为“|”就是将参与运算两个数对应二进制进行比较,如果一个为1,另一个为0,则结果为1,否则,结果位为0。python中运算符为“^”下面用9和3为操作对象两个例子解释一下:十进制9  对应二进制为
转载 2023-05-27 15:00:26
702阅读
# Python 字符实现方法 ## 1. 引言 在Python中,可以使用操作符(^)对两个字符进行运算。运算是一种逻辑运算,它对两个二进制数相应进行比较,如果相应值不同,则结果为1,否则为0。本文将介绍如何实现Python字符方法,并提供详细步骤和示例代码。 ## 2. 方法 下面是实现Python字符步骤: 步骤 |
原创 2023-12-29 06:24:38
89阅读
运算符有:&(与)、|()、^()、~ (取反)。优先级从高到低,依次为~、&、^、|1. 与操作 0&0=0; 0&1=0; 1&0=0; 1&1=1例子:10&9: 0000 1010 & 0000 1001 = 0000 1000 = 8负数补码形式参加按与运算“与运算”特殊用途: (1)清零。
  • 1
  • 2
  • 3
  • 4
  • 5